Roofing repairs vary based on a few key factors. The specific material on your roof, such as asphalt shingles versus metal, plays a significant role. We also look at the total square footage of the damaged area, how easily accessible the roof is, and whether there is hidden water damage underneath the surface. If structural repairs are needed to fix rotting wood or flashing, the labor hours will increase. Every roof presents unique conditions. Exact pricing confirmed free on the call.

Homeowners insurance in Columbus, Georgia, might cover roof repairs if the damage is due to specific events like severe weather or falling objects. However, typical wear and tear or issues arising from poor maintenance are usually excluded. It's wise to consult with a roofing pro about potential claims. Call for a free consultation.
